Origin of "Top"
The word "top" originates from the Old English "topp," meaning the highest point or a tuft. Its usage evolved to signify superiority or excellence over time.
Etymology of "Corporate"
"Corporate" stems from the Latin "corporatus," meaning "to form into a body." It reflects the gathering of individuals into a single legal entity focused on joint interests.
History of "Managers"
"Managers" traces back to the Italian "maneggiare," meaning to handle or control. This evolved into the act of directing people and resources effectively.
